The name Jada has roots in both Arabic and English. In Arabic, it is derived from 'jada,' meaning 'gift' or 'goodness,' while in English, it is associated with the precious green stone jade, symbolizing beauty, purity, and protection. The name gained popularity in the late 20th century, particularly in English-speaking countries.
